How Google Removing Rightside Ads From SERPS Affects Organic SEO
Few layout changes have influenced the search landscape as much as Google removing right side ads from its desktop results pages. What once was a sidebar full of paid listings became a cleaner page where ads moved to the top and bottom of results. For businesses relying on organic search, this shift changed the competitive dynamics dramatically. Understanding what happened and how the results page continues to evolve is essential for anyone who wants to protect and grow their organic visibility.

What Actually Changed on the Results Page
Removing right side ads consolidated paid listings into the top and bottom of the page. On competitive commercial queries, this often meant more ads stacked above the organic results, pushing the first organic listing further down the page. The change made premium above the fold real estate scarcer and more valuable. For businesses, it underscored a simple truth: ranking on page one is no longer enough if your listing sits below several ads and other features that dominate the visible area.
Organic Visibility Became More Competitive
With less visible space for organic results, the value of ranking in the very top positions increased. The difference between the first and fifth organic result grew more pronounced because users had to scroll past ads before reaching organic listings. This raised the stakes for on page optimization, content quality, and authority building. Brands that had comfortably ranked in mid page positions suddenly found their visibility and click through rates squeezed, making genuine competitiveness more important than ever.
The Rise of SERP Features
The cleaner layout also made room for the many rich features that now populate results pages, from featured snippets and knowledge panels to local packs and people also ask boxes. These features can capture attention and clicks before traditional organic listings even appear. Optimizing to earn these features has become a critical part of modern SEO. Structured content, clear answers, and schema markup all help your pages qualify for these prominent placements that a well planned digital marketing strategy actively targets.
Click Through Behavior Evolved
As the results page changed, so did user behavior. Some users learned to scroll past ads to reach organic listings they trust, while others engaged more with the rich features at the top. Understanding these behavior patterns helps you optimize not just for rankings but for actual clicks. A listing that earns a featured snippet or a compelling meta description can outperform a higher ranked but less enticing result. Winning attention now requires both strong rankings and persuasive presentation.
Why Strong Organic Rankings Still Win
Despite the growth of ads and features, organic listings remain deeply trusted by users. Many searchers deliberately skip ads and gravitate toward organic results they perceive as more credible. This is why investing in organic SEO continues to deliver strong returns. Earning the top organic positions, appearing in rich features, and building a trustworthy brand presence all combine to capture the attention that ads alone cannot buy. Trust remains a powerful advantage that compounds over time.
